Job Summary
ARC is looking for a graduate Psychologist to be based in Harare in Zimbabwe. Reporting to the Clinic Supervisor and working closely with the Nurse Counsellors, the Psychologist will provide psychotherapy, including follow-up therapy and facilitating support groups for SGBV survivors. She/He will also work with the Outreach and Training Teams to implement their duties and achieve goals.
Duties And Responsibilities
1. Performing psychological assessments and evaluations and offering somatic psychotherapy self-care techniques to survivors, care-givers and ARC staff;
2. Providing team consultation and psycho-education to Nurse-Counsellors and multi-sectoral stakeholders;
3. Survivor history intake and records keeping;
4. Submitting monthly, quarterly and annual activity plans reports to the Clinic Supervisor and Monitoring and Evaluation Officer
Qualifications And Experience
BSc Psychology
Advanced qualification in Psychology will be an added advantage
Exceptional report writing and communication skills; High level of personal integrity; Strong work ethic; Ability to respect survivor confidentiality.
Fluency in oral and written English is essential; Ability to communicate in local languages; Ability to communicate in sign language is an added advantage
Proficiency in the use of computers for Microsoft Word, Microsoft Excel, Microsoft Publisher, Microsoft PowerPoint
